─────────────── t h e ────────────── ▄▄▄▄ ▄▄▄▄ ▄▄ ▄▄ ▄▄▄▄ ▄▄ ▄▄ ▄▄ ▄▄▄▄ ██▐█▌ ▐█▌██ ██ ██ ▐█▌██ ██ ██ ██ ▐█▌██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██▐█▌ ▐█▌ ▐█▌██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██▀▀ ▀▀█▄ ▀▀██ ██ ██ ██▀██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██ ▐█▌ ▐█▌██ ██ ██ ██ ▐█▌██ ▀▀ ▀▀▀ ▀▀▀ ▀▀▀ ▀▀ ▀▀ ▀▀ ▀▀▀ M O N K S ────────────────────────────────────── "BABYLON" released at assembly96, 16 august 1996 Running notes: ■ at least an 80mhz machine to get synching to look good; a dx4/100 or a P5 will suffice well ■ a decent video card ■ a decent sound card :) (sb/gus/pas) ■ NO EMM386 or QEMM; on a 4 meg machine you will have to boot clean with himem.sys only to work.. on an 8 meg machine it should be fine regardless General blather: This was supposed to be out at NAID96 but unfortunately we didn't realize the tremendous chore linking was going to be. Also, we were farther from completion than we thought we were. In any case, I think this version is much better :) Creditos: necros - main synch coding, voxel landscape, comet effect, recursive texture effect, env mapper, font routines, crossfader, radial fire, etc - music :) solstice - vector engine basics, 'pillars' effect, 'babylon' mesh, moral support, poetry likuid krystal - that weird swirly thing, clock timer source pelusa - music replay routines, voxel tunnel, radix sort ;) ior - chaos attractor, travel agent, silly web designer AHEM iv/carcass - PM logo aahz/carcass - vector morphing symbol objects and backgif Futuristiq: We have no plans to do anything ever again :) Should one of us get bored, you'll probably see another EDEN. If not, well such is life. Hopefully if NAID97 ends up happening we'll try to kick some butt there too. Oh, and btw we are North American (except for pelusa who is fortunate enough to be South American) so forgive us for lack of inspiringly random finnish text and shaky static filters.
